Position in the ranking is based on each scientist’s D-index using data compiled from OpenAlex and CrossRef by December 21st 2022.

This ranking lists all the best researchers from the Microbiology discipline and affiliated with Nagasaki University. There are a total of 6 researchers included with 1 of them also being included in the global ranking. The total sum for the D-index values for the best scientists in Nagasaki University is 347 with a mean value for the h-index of 57.83. The total sum of publications for the best scientists in Nagasaki University is 2,576 with the mean value for publications per scientist of 429.33.
